In historic footage and interviews, Harvey Littleon, Dominick Labino, and others discuss the Studio Glass Movement's rise and the innovations they pioneered that transformed glassblowing into a celebrated art form. Three contemporary artists Baker O'Brien, Shawn Messenger, and Mark Matthews are also profiled.
